"Connecting Alexa to Your Hisense Smart TV: The How-To Guide"
If you are the proud owner of a Hisense smart TV and an Alexa device, you might be wondering if you can connect the two. The answer is yes, and in this guide, we will walk you through the steps you need to take to make it happen.
First, you will need to make sure that your Hisense smart TV is compatible with Alexa. Most newer models should be. Check the specifications of your TV to confirm that it supports Alexa.
Next, you need to enable the Alexa skill for your Hisense TV. To do this, open the Alexa app on your smartphone or tablet, and navigate to the Skills & Games section. Search for the Hisense skill and enable it. Then, link your Hisense account to your Alexa account.
Now, you can start using Alexa to control your TV. You can say things like "Alexa, turn on my TV," or "Alexa, change the channel to ESPN." You can also use Alexa to search for content on your TV, adjust the volume, and more.
Note that you may need to make some adjustments to your TV settings to ensure that Alexa has full control. For example, you may need to turn on HDMI CEC (Consumer Electronics Control) to allow Alexa to turn your TV on and off.
